WebNov 30, 2024 · Living robots are known as xenobots: tiny life forms less than a millimeter (0.4 inches) wide that were created from the stem cells of African clawed frogs (Xenopus laevis), from which they get their name. The machine-animal hybrids that their creators say are “an entirely new life form,” as reported by inews, were first announced by the ... To persist, life must reproduce. Over billions of years, organisms have evolved many ways of replicating, from budding plants to sexual animals to invading viruses.

WebDec 3, 2024 · December 3, 2024 at 11:26 am. Tiny “living machines” made of frog cells can replicate themselves, making copies that can then go on to do the same.
